Global hybrid drivetrain market was valued at $160.9 billion in 2025 and is projected to reach $1,817.2 billion by 2035, growing at a CAGR of 27.5% from 2026 to 2035. The global hybrid drivetrain market is witnessing robust growth driven by increasing consumer demand for fuel-efficient and environmentally friendly vehicles. Rising regulatory pressure to reduce carbon emissions is encouraging automakers to adopt hybrid powertrain technologies. Advances in electric motor efficiency, battery performance, and power electronics are further enhancing the appeal of hybrid vehicles. Growing investments in research and development by key manufacturers are facilitating the introduction of innovative drivetrain solutions. Additionally, expanding urbanization and the shift toward sustainable transportation are supporting market expansion. The combination of technological advancements and favorable government policies is reinforcing the market’s long-term growth trajectory.
Adoption of Advanced Power Electronics
The integration of advanced power electronics in hybrid drivetrains is improving energy efficiency and system reliability. Modern inverters, converters, and controllers enable seamless energy transfer between electric motors and batteries, optimizing performance. Manufacturers are increasingly focusing on lightweight and compact designs to reduce vehicle weight and improve fuel economy. The trend is also driven by the rising use of high-voltage architectures that support higher power output and longer driving ranges. Enhanced thermal management systems in power electronics are further contributing to performance stability. As a result, this trend is accelerating the adoption of hybrid drivetrains in both passenger and commercial vehicles.
Expansion of Plug-in Hybrid Electric Vehicles (PHEVs)
The market is witnessing significant growth in plug-in hybrid electric vehicles due to consumer preference for longer electric-only driving ranges. PHEVs combine the benefits of conventional engines with enhanced electric mobility, reducing dependence on fossil fuels. Continuous improvements in battery energy density and charging infrastructure are making PHEVs more practical for everyday use. Automakers are introducing new models with competitive pricing and extended warranties to attract adoption. Government incentives and subsidies for plug-in hybrids are also stimulating demand. Consequently, the increasing popularity of PHEVs is reshaping the hybrid drivetrain landscape globally.

Battery Pack Segment to Lead the Market with the Largest Share
Within components, the battery pack segment accounts for the largest share of revenue, driven by the critical role of energy storage in hybrid systems. Continuous improvements in energy density, thermal management, and lifecycle performance are increasing its value contribution per vehicle. Leading manufacturers are heavily investing in advanced lithium-ion and solid-state battery technologies to meet growing hybrid adoption.
Full HEV: A Key Segment in Market Growth
Full hybrid electric vehicles (Full HEVs) lead the hybrid drivetrain market by combining engine and electric power for better fuel efficiency and lower emissions. They are widely used in passenger cars and urban transport, supported by regulatory incentives and consumer demand for efficiency. Advances in battery technology and power electronics enhance performance, while established manufacturing and proven reliability reinforce their global dominance.

North America Region Dominates the Market with Major Share
North America is a key market for hybrid drivetrains, primarily driven by the United States. The region benefits from strong regulatory support, including stringent emission standards and government incentives that promote the adoption of fuel-efficient and low-emission vehicles. Major automakers in the US and Canada are actively investing in hybrid and electrified drivetrain technologies, integrating advanced battery packs, power electronics, and efficient motors into their vehicle portfolios. Rising consumer awareness of sustainability, combined with expanding urban mobility solutions and fleet electrification programs, is further boosting demand. The presence of established OEMs and Tier-1 suppliers, coupled with significant R&D infrastructure, ensures North America remains a leading market for hybrid drivetrain growth.
Asia-Pacific Region to Provide Substantial Growth Rate
Asia-Pacific is the fastest-growing region in the hybrid drivetrain market, led by China, Japan, and India. China dominates due to aggressive policies encouraging hybrid and electric vehicle adoption, including subsidies, tax incentives, and production mandates for automakers. Japan’s long-established hybrid technology expertise and high consumer acceptance of hybrid vehicles reinforce the region’s market leadership. Rapid urbanization, increasing vehicle ownership, and rising environmental awareness are further accelerating demand. Investments in battery manufacturing, local R&D centers, and advanced powertrain production by automakers across the region are strengthening Asia-Pacific’s position as a critical growth hub for hybrid drivetrain adoption.
